## Onboarding: The Quarrel Planner Regression

New hires should read the postmortem for the Quarrel 3.1 query planner regression before touching optimizer code. A cost-model change caused nested-loop joins to be chosen over hash joins on the Tellbrook cluster, inflating p99 latency for two days. We now gate every planner change behind the `plan-diff` harness, and all harness result bundles must be signed before the CI gate at Marnview accepts them. Sign the bundle using the team's current signing key, which is as follows.

deploy key for yajop-fahop: bky3_h1v

Onboarding note for the Ledgerpane admin table: bulk edits are applied through the batcher service, not directly against the database. Select rows, choose an action, and the batcher stages changes in a pending set you can review before commit. Edits over 500 rows require a second approver — this is enforced server-side, so don't try to chunk around it. To run the batcher locally you need the staging write credential, which goes in your .env as the next line.

secret setting of bahip-kagag: RELAY_SECRET3=c83

## Break-Glass Access — FareSplit Pricing Experiment

The FareSplit ticket-pricing experiment runs behind a sealed feature-flag service. If the flag console is unreachable during a release and pricing must be frozen, break-glass access is permitted for the release manager only. Log the incident, disable the experiment arm, and notify the pricing guild within one hour. The break-glass console accepts the recovery passphrase shown below.

unlock words, kajeg-fahif: holmir-casael-novdor

## Deploying the Gatewick Proctor Queue

Deploys are pretty painless: push to main, wait for the pipeline, then watch the queue drain dashboard for five minutes. If candidates pile up mid-exam, roll back first and ask questions later — the queue replays safely. Everything the workers care about lives in one config block, shown here for reference.

settings of bafof-yagef:
JOROX_PIN=8740
JOROX_TENANT=pelox
JOROX_METRICS_HOST=metrics.jorox.qorvelworks.internal
JOROX_SEAL=seal_c78f63c1
JOROX_STANDBY_TEAM=norax